Evansville Mater Dei state champions in baseball for first time in 27 years
Evansville Mater Dei digs deep, defeats Bluffton in extra innings to win Class 2A state baseball championship.
INDIANAPOLIS — There may not be a way to sum up this moment properly.Mater Dei coach Adam Wildeman was searching for the right words, but failing. His focus was being pulled in multiple directions as he navigated a full concourse of well wishes and hugs.
Same for Max Miller, a senior who walked off this field with dejection last year but is now placing a jersey inside the Victory Field trophy case. You can pinpoint to a dozen others who may spend the entire offseason trying to describe what occurred on Saturday.Because with their backs against the wall, the Wildcats found the answer.
Again.Instate recap: Mater Dei outlasts Bluffton in thriller to win 2A baseball titleNo. 1 Mater Dei defeated Bluffton 6-3 in eight innings to win the IHSAA Class 2A state championship on Saturday.
The Wildcats were down to their final out before completing a story which took multiple trips to Indianapolis to finish.For the first time in 27 years, this program earned the right to be state champions."It wasn’t just today," Wildeman said.
"It wasn’t just last week. It's been all year long. These guys just fight and claw and find different ways to win baseball games.
Tough to put into words that does justice, but it truly is an honor to be the head coach."This was, in some ways, three decades in the making. Mater Dei played in the state championship four times since winning the 1999 title.
All four visits ended in defeat. It was also an evolution of growth for a team who was eight outs from this same opportunity last season but failed.What went down over the final innings at Victory Field proved Mater Dei (30-3) was finally ready.
Jackson Schaefer tied the game on a swinging bunt with two outs in the seventh. One inning later, again with two outs, four straight batters reached base for the Wildcats. The final two were the loudest with Miller driving home the go-ahead run and Dylan Murphy supplying a two-RBI rocket up the middle for good measure.
